Given Input numbers are 301, 697, 55, 258
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 301
List of positive integer divisors of 301 that divides 301 without a remainder.
1, 7, 43, 301
Divisors of 697
List of positive integer divisors of 697 that divides 697 without a remainder.
1, 17, 41, 697
Divisors of 55
List of positive integer divisors of 55 that divides 55 without a remainder.
1, 5, 11, 55
Divisors of 258
List of positive integer divisors of 258 that divides 258 without a remainder.
1, 2, 3, 6, 43, 86, 129, 258
Greatest Common Divisior
We found the divisors of 301, 697, 55, 258 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 301, 697, 55, 258 is 1.
Therefore, GCD of numbers 301, 697, 55, 258 is 1
Given Input Data is 301, 697, 55, 258
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 301 is 7 x 43
Prime Factorization of 697 is 17 x 41
Prime Factorization of 55 is 5 x 11
Prime Factorization of 258 is 2 x 3 x 43
The above numbers do not have any common prime factor. So GCD is 1
